Stumm: Meine Erlebnisse bei der Englischen Expedition in Abyssinien (1868)

When Magdala fell into the hands of the English expeditionary force on April 13, 1868, there were attached journalists, translators and diplomats who witnessed the incident. The German diplomat Ferdinand von Stumm, together with the explorer and adventurer Friedrich Gerhard Rohlfs, were among the first people to enter Madgala and witness the chaotic situation unfolding and the extensive loot of precious manuscripts, archival materials, regalia and other valuable objects. As an eyewitness, Stumm was able to record an extensive list of objects that were looted from the citadel.
